1

Machine Learning Engineer Python Jobs in Santa Clara, CA

Sr. Machine Learning Engineer

Santa Clara, CA · On-site

$143K - $189K/yr

Our team comprises a diverse range of backgrounds, including applied machine learning engineers ... C/C++, Go, Python, Java Preferred Qualifications Masters or PhD in the area of Computer Science or ...

Machine Learning Engineer

San Jose, CA · On-site

$96K - $128K/yr

We are looking for a Machine Learning Engineer to join our team of driven machine learning and ... Strong Python software engineering skills, including system design, clean architecture, testing, CI ...

Machine Learning Engineer

San Jose, CA

$96K - $128K/yr

We are looking for a Machine Learning Engineer to join our team of driven machine learning and ... Strong Python software engineering skills, including system design, clean architecture, testing, CI ...

Role Summary We are seeking a highly motivated Machine Learning Engineer with a strong background ... Proficiency in Python and ML libraries/frameworks such as PyTorch, TensorFlow, etc. * Solid ...

As a Senior Machine Learning Engineer , you'll play a pivotal role in designing, building, and ... Strong programming skills in Python and familiarity with ML frameworks such as TensorFlow , PyTorch ...

Senior Machine Learning Engineer

San Jose, CA · On-site

$122K - $168K/yr

Required : • Proven experience building and deploying machine learning models in production environments • Strong programming skills in Python and familiarity with ML frameworks such as ...

Senior Machine Learning Engineer

San Jose, CA · On-site

$143K - $189K/yr

Required : • Proven experience building and deploying machine learning models in production environments • Strong programming skills in Python and familiarity with ML frameworks such as ...

Apple's Health Sensing team is seeking a versatile Machine Learning Engineer to develop next ... Python for algorithm development and optimization Demonstrated ability to rapidly prototype ...

Machine Learning Engineer II

Palo Alto, CA · On-site +1

$114K - $156K/yr

Proficiency in Python and at least one additional programming language such as Java, Kotlin, Go, Scala, or a similar language * Strong understanding of machine learning fundamentals, including model ...

Machine Learning Engineer II

Palo Alto, CA · On-site +1

$114K - $156K/yr

Proficiency in Python and at least one additional programming language such as Java, Kotlin, Go, Scala, or a similar language * Strong understanding of machine learning fundamentals, including model ...

next page

Showing results 1-20

Machine Learning Engineer Python information

See Santa Clara, CA salary details

$27K

$164.4K

$237.8K

How much do machine learning engineer python jobs pay per year?

As of Jun 25, 2026, the average yearly pay for machine learning engineer python in Santa Clara, CA is $164,387.00, according to ZipRecruiter salary data. Most workers in this role earn between $129,800.00 and $193,200.00 per year, depending on experience, location, and employer.

What are some common challenges faced by Machine Learning Engineers working with Python, and how can they be addressed?

Machine Learning Engineers using Python often encounter challenges such as managing large datasets, ensuring efficient model deployment, and maintaining reproducibility of experiments. Handling data pipelines and model versioning can be complex, especially as projects scale. To address these issues, engineers typically use tools like Pandas and Dask for data handling, Docker for containerization, and MLflow or DVC for tracking experiments and models. Collaborating closely with data engineers, software developers, and product teams is also essential to streamline workflows and ensure models are production-ready.

What are the key skills and qualifications needed to thrive as a Machine Learning Engineer Python, and why are they important?

To thrive as a Machine Learning Engineer Python, you need a solid background in computer science, statistics, and mathematics, along with proficiency in Python programming and machine learning concepts. Familiarity with frameworks such as TensorFlow, PyTorch, Scikit-learn, and experience with cloud platforms or MLOps tools are highly valued, as are certifications like Google Professional Machine Learning Engineer. Strong problem-solving abilities, communication skills, and a collaborative mindset help set you apart in this field. These skills enable engineers to design, implement, and deploy effective machine learning solutions that address real-world challenges in dynamic, team-oriented environments.

What is the difference between Machine Learning Engineer Python vs Data Scientist?

AspectMachine Learning Engineer PythonData Scientist
Required CredentialsBachelor's/Master's in CS, Data Science, or related; Python skills; ML certificationsBachelor's/Master's in Statistics, CS, or related; Python/R skills; Data analysis certifications
Work EnvironmentDevelops scalable ML models, deploys algorithms, collaborates with engineering teamsAnalyzes data, builds models, interprets results, communicates insights
Employer & Industry UsageTech companies, startups, AI-focused firmsFinance, healthcare, marketing, research institutions

While both roles require Python proficiency and data skills, Machine Learning Engineers focus on building and deploying scalable ML models, whereas Data Scientists analyze data and generate insights. The roles often overlap but differ in their primary focus and responsibilities.

What is a Machine Learning Engineer Python?

A Machine Learning Engineer Python is a professional who uses the Python programming language to design, build, and deploy machine learning models and systems. They work with large datasets, develop algorithms, and use Python libraries such as TensorFlow, scikit-learn, and PyTorch to solve complex problems. Their responsibilities also include preprocessing data, training models, evaluating performance, and integrating solutions into production environments. Machine Learning Engineers often collaborate with data scientists, software engineers, and business stakeholders to create scalable and efficient machine learning applications.
What cities near Santa Clara, CA are hiring for Machine Learning Engineer Python jobs? Cities near Santa Clara, CA with the most Machine Learning Engineer Python job openings:
Infographic showing various Machine Learning Engineer Python job openings in Santa Clara, CA as of June 2026, with employment types broken down into 85% Full Time, 13% Part Time, and 2% Contract. Highlights an 82% Physical, 5% Hybrid, and 13% Remote job distribution, with an average salary of $164,387 per year, or $79 per hour.
Sr. Machine Learning Engineer

Sr. Machine Learning Engineer

Apple

Santa Clara, CA • On-site

$143K - $189K/yr

Full-time

Posted 13 days ago


Apple rating

8.1

Company rating: 8.1 out of 10

Based on 662 frontline employees who took The Breakroom Quiz

6th of 30 rated technology retailers


Job description

Are you interested in enhancing the capabilities of Siri and Apple products to benefit our users? The Siri and Information Intelligence team is revolutionizing how hundreds of millions of people utilize their devices to access information. As an Applied ML team, we are pushing the boundaries to provide our users with the utmost optimal direct, secure, and privacy-preserving experiences, simultaneously delivering Apple-level design and aesthetics through generative AI techniques.
Our team comprises a diverse range of backgrounds, including applied machine learning engineers with a focus on ML and LLM, and experienced distributed systems engineers. As such, we are seeking candidates with applied machine learning experience and strong software engineering skills.
Description
Leverage and enhance the latest advancements in machine learning and software engineering to effectively contribute to the successful delivery of generative experiences.
Develop world-class evaluation techniques to ensure the accurate measurement and calibration of model responses.
Collaborate with diverse teams, including infrastructure, quality, data, product, and design, to develop innovative features and contribute to the creation of an exceptional search experience for our end-users.
Mentor aspiring applied scientists and engineers to broaden their horizons and amplify their impact. Contribute to the formation of a world-class team!
Minimum Qualifications
Bachelors in Computer Science, Artificial Intelligence, Machine Learning, Information Retrieval, Data Science or related field or equivalent work experience
6+ years of industry related experience, working in collaborative environments
Experience with using: PyTorch, TensorFlow, or JAX for training and deploying deep learning models
Understanding product requirements then translating them into modeling tasks and engineering tasks
Proficient in at least two programming languages such as: C/C++, Go, Python, Java
Preferred Qualifications
Masters or PhD in the area of Computer Science or equivalent, or a related
Knowledge and prior experience with some deep learning and GenAI frameworks are desired.
Building machine-learned models for search relevance ranking query understanding and questioning
Prior experience in consumer facing product is desired

What Apple employ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om


Apple logo

About Apple

Sourced by ZipRecruiter

Imagine what you could do here! At Apple, new ideas have a way of becoming extraordinary products, services, and customer experiences very quickly. Bring passion and dedication to your job and there's no telling what you could accomplish. Dynamic, intelligent people and inspiring, innovative technologies are the norm here. The people who work here have reinvented entire industries with all Apple Hardware products. The same real passion for innovation that goes into our products also applies to our practices strengthening our dedication to leave the world better than we found it.

Industry

Computer and electronic product manufacturing

Company size

10,000+ Employees

Headquarters location

Cupertino, CA, US

Year founded

1976